While it was all tied up 1-1 at halftime, Eastern Randolph was not quite Asheboro's equal in the second half on Thursday. They lost 5-2 to the Blue Comets. Eastern Randolph's defeat continues a trend for the squad, making it six in a row.
Eastern Randolph's loss dropped their record down to 2-12-2. As for Asheboro, they are on a roll lately: they've won five of their last six cont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 11-5 record this season.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Eastern Randolph will take on Southwestern Randolph at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. Eastern Randolph will be up against Southwestern Randolph's rather soft defense (which has allowed 3.88 goals per matchup), so fans could be in store for a big offensive performance. As for Asheboro, they will challenge Central Davidson at 6:30 p.m. on Monday.
